NASA has once again showcased the beauty of our planet with mesmerizing nighttime images of Earth captured from the International Space Station (ISS).
Among the photos, India stands out as a glowing spectacle under a starlit sky, with its dense network of city lights forming intricate spider-web patterns across the subcontinent.
The image of India, shared on NASA’s official account, highlights the vast urban landscapes illuminated beneath the cosmic expanse, creating an awe-inspiring view. Social media users reacted with amazement, with one remarking, “We spread out like spider webs.”
Other images from the series include the cloud-covered U.S. Midwest, the coastal and inland contours of Southeast Asia, and Canada glowing under a green aurora—a reminder of Earth’s diverse and magnificent natural beauty.
